

Clear glass footed dish with a wide bowl and short stem. The bowl features a scalloped edge and is covered in clear glass hobnails. The base of the dish is round with a decorative edge featuring the same hobnails as the bowl. The short stem connecting the bowl to the base is also clear glass. The entire dish is clear with no visible color or pattern other than the hobnail texture. The background of the image is dark gray. The dish sits on a lighter gray surface.
